Lincoln MKX
Posted January 6, 2007 at 1:00 am Make a Comment

The Lincoln MKX makes a refined luxury statement with its dynamic American styling. Its distinctive chrome grille, clean, flowing lines and broad-shouldered athletic stance communicate confidence and elegance. Eighteen-inch Euroflange wheels and dual chrome exhaust tips signal power and performance. Wraparound tail lamps and a spoiler complete the rear.

Innovative technologies on the Lincoln MKX combine art and functionality. An all-glass available panoramic Vista Roof™ allows customers to experience open-air freedom at the touch of a button. Distinctive lighting includes a Lincoln first: available adaptive headlamps that swivel around curves, pivoting as the driver steers and lighting up to 36 more feet of roadway around a corner. In addition, an LED liftgate panel provides edge-to-edge illumination.

Inside, the five-passenger Lincoln MKX delivers exceptional comfort along with Lincoln’s hallmark craftsmanship. Its luxurious leather seating features Ford’s first application of its patent-pending Active Comfort Engineering process, with specialized contours helping to reduce pressure points and fatigue. The second-row seats recline to a best-in-class angle and can fold and pivot in one movement. Lincoln MKX provides comfort for all passengers, no matter the temperature, with available heated and cooled seats. The spacious center console offers customers versatility, with a standard MP3 audio jack and a power point hidden inside. Three additional power points also are provided in the cabin.
